Literature on tree crown management, including topping and branch prun
ing, is reviewed to provide information to foresters who are managing
conifer seed orchards. The production of short, wide tree crowns facil
itates cone harvesting, supplemental mass or controlled pollination, a
nd the control of insects and diseases. However, the changes in tree a
rchitecture can also cause problems that result in self pollination an
d vulnerablity to physical damage.
